N330GR

N330GR (msn 447), an A320-231 owned by Beijing Eternity Technologies, is being ferried by Nomadic Aviation as OMD382. It's being ferried from TUS to FOC [Changle Airport, Fuzhou, China], via JRF, MAJ, and GUM. N330GR is making a brief fuel stop at JRF this afternoon. According to the Instagram post from Nomadic Aviation, this A320 will become a maintenance trainer.

447's History:
Dec 1993: Delivered to Dragonair as VR-HYU, under lease from ILFC.
Aug 1997: Re-registered as B-HYU, after Hong Kong was handed over to the People's Republic of China.
Mar 1999: Leased to Transmeridian Airlines as N447TM.
Apr 1999: Subleased to Aeropostal.
Mar 2001: Leased Skyservice Airlines, and subleased to Roots Air as C-FRAR.
Jun 2003: Leased to Mexicana Airlines as N447MX "Minatitlán".
Mar 2004: Re-registered as XA-UAH.
Oct 2011: Leased to Sky Airline as CC-ADO.
Oct 2015: Leased to Danish Air Transport as OY-RUS.
Dec 2018: Withdrawn from service, and stored at SOF.
Feb 2020: Ferried to TUS for storage, and acquired by Elevate Jet as N330GR, a month later.
Oct 2024: Acquired by Beijing Eternity Technologies.
